In a small town, a group of misfits with a history of traffic violations finds themselves in the same situation: they must complete a rehabilitation program for drivers. The story follows a series of eccentric characters, each with their own reasons for being in trouble, from a young dreamer to a veteran who hasn't moved past his glory days. The instructor, a no-nonsense police sergeant, isn't one for games and seems to enjoy making the students feel miserable.
However, as chaos unfolds in and out of the classroom, the protagonists begin to form unexpected bonds, laughing together and sharing their life stories. Their experience in the rehabilitation program takes a hilarious turn when they decide to confront their instructor about his troubled driving experiences. Amidst all of this, absurd situations arise: car chases, comedic accidents, and an elaborate plan to prove their worth.
With a touch of romance and camaraderie, the group decides to unite against the injustices of the legal system that has led them to this predicament. As they confront their fears and challenge the rules, the experience becomes more than just a driving course; it transforms into a journey of redemption and friendship. Undoubtedly, it's a comedy that mixes absurd situations with moments of self-reflection, reminding us that sometimes, all we need is a little support to turn our lives around.
